Cavaliers, clubs, and literary culture : Sir John Mennes, James Smith, and the Order of the Fancy /
Cavaliers, Clubs, and Literary Culture is centered around the lives and poetry of Sir John Mennes (a naval officer) and his friend James Smith (a debauched cleric) in Stuart and Interregnum England.
